Output 18a369af7574dcdf29506e0fc530535e28439a71671e3ef86c87aa7f2e7031e8:9

value
50783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afd51dc83e2a2867009200c0c27fb9846576487 OP_EQUAL
address
3MevhL39vPXYrGVGK2kCiGsoSxVB67qipv
transaction
18a369af7574dcdf29506e0fc530535e28439a71671e3ef86c87aa7f2e7031e8
spent
true